编写可维护的JavaScript代码

前端开发者说 2019-10-30 ⋅ 15 阅读

JavaScript是一种广泛使用的脚本语言,用于开发网页和移动应用程序。然而,由于其灵活性和动态特性,编写可维护的JavaScript代码是一项具有挑战性的任务。在本篇博客中,我将分享一些编写可维护JavaScript代码的最佳实践。

1. 使用有意义的变量和函数命名

使用有意义的变量和函数命名是编写可维护JavaScript代码的关键。避免使用单个字母或缩写作为变量名,而是使用描述性的名称,以便于其他开发人员理解代码的含义。例如,使用var totalPrice而不是var tp

2. 模块化代码

将代码划分为小模块可以提高代码的可维护性。模块化代码可以使代码更易于理解、测试和维护。可以使用对象、函数或类来实现模块化。

3. 避免全局变量

全局变量容易导致代码冲突和命名冲突。为了避免这个问题,最好将变量和函数限定在局部作用域中。使用闭包或命名空间等方法可以有效地限制全局变量的使用。

4. 注释代码

良好的注释可以提高代码的可读性和可维护性。在代码中使用注释来解释其用途、原理或特定行为。这样做可以帮助其他开发人员理解代码,并使日后的维护工作更加容易。

5. 使用代码规范

遵循一致的代码规范可以使代码更容易阅读和理解。使用空格、缩进、换行和命名约定等代码规范可以使代码具有良好的可维护性。

6. 异常处理

合理地处理异常可以增加代码的健壮性和可维护性。在代码中使用try-catch语句来捕获和处理可能发生的异常。这样可以避免代码中的错误造成整个应用程序的崩溃。

7. 避免重复代码

避免重复代码是编写可维护JavaScript代码的另一个重要方面。重复的代码不仅增加了代码的体积,还增加了代码的维护成本。通过封装重复的代码为可复用的函数或组件,可以减少代码的重复性。

结论

编写可维护的JavaScript代码需要考虑多个因素,如变量命名、模块化、全局变量、注释、代码规范、异常处理和避免重复代码等。通过采用这些最佳实践,我们可以提高代码的可读性、可测试性和可维护性。这将大大减少代码错误和提高开发效率。希望通过本篇博客的分享,可以帮助读者编写更好的JavaScript代码。


全部评论: 0

    我有话说: